Overview

Platycodonis radix polysaccharides (PRP) are bioactive compounds derived from the root of *Platycodon grandiflorus* (Balloon Flower). These polysaccharides, particularly the fraction designated as PG1, demonstrate significant anti-obesity effects by modulating the gut microbiota and metabolic pathways. The mechanism of action involves the activation of the gut microbiota-short-chain fatty acid (SCFA)-G protein-coupled receptor (GPR) pathway, specifically increasing the expression of GPR41 and GPR43, which leads to elevated levels of satiety hormones such as GLP-1 and PYY. Additionally, PRP inhibits the gut microbiota-bile acid (BA)-farnesoid X receptor (FXR)-fibroblast growth factor 15 (FGF15) signaling axis, resulting in the upregulation of hepatic CYP7A1 and accelerated liver cholesterol metabolism. These actions collectively suppress weight gain, improve lipid profiles, and reduce inflammation and liver damage in high-fat diet-induced obesity models.
